Reliant Medical Group in Worcester has an opening for a full-time Lead Breast Ultrasound Technologist. This career opportunity offers great compensation, full benefits, 401k match, paid holidays, and weekday hours within a positive, close-knit, team-oriented environment. This position oversees breast ultrasound services across multiple locations in the local area, and very limited travel between them may be required.


Primary Responsibilities:

Under the direct supervision of the Ultrasound Supervisor, this role provides technical and administrative leadership for the Breast Imaging Department



  • In addition to the principal duties and responsibilities of a staff sonographer, the Lead Breast Ultrasound Technologist will assist the Ultrasound Supervisor in coordinating the daily operations of the Breast Imaging Department and facilitate outstanding patient care

  • Maintain a strong collaborative relationship with department leadership, ordering providers, radiologists, staff technologists, and support staff

  • Work with the Ultrasound Supervisor and Lead Radiologist to coordinate daily patient flow, imaging protocols updates, and workflow enhancements

  • Maintain accurate records of performed and interpreted exams and procedures within Breast Imaging

  • Monitor compliance with recommendations for follow-up studies

  • Oversee the maintenance and tracking of pathological results from biopsies

  • Perform quality control and quality assurance for exams and equipment as established by the department. Identifies equipment problems and communicates to immediate supervisor

  • Track inventory and place supplies orders for the Breast Imaging Department as needed

  • Assist Ultrasound Supervisor with ACR accreditation, organizational assessments, and state inspections as needed. Assist clerical and support staff as necessary

  • Aid Ultrasound Supervisor in the training and ongoing development of breast imaging technologists and support staff as required

  • Perform related administrative duties as needed

Required Qualifications:



  • Graduate of an AMA accredited ultrasound program or equivalent

  • BLS (Basic Life Support) certified and maintain this certification during employment

  • Certified in breast imaging by the American Registry for Diagnostic Medical Sonography (ARDMS)

  • Maintain all required continuing education credits and licensure during employment

  • 3+ years ultrasound experience

  • Competent to perform ultrasound exams on newborns, children, adults, and geriatric patients, meeting all department guidelines

  • Thorough knowledge of equipment operations, imaging techniques, protocols, and equipment troubleshooting

  • Physical health sufficient to meet the ergonomic standards and demands of the position
